Conclusion

This drive has truly impressed me. I never would imagine such a small drive packing such a fast transfer rate. At first glance, other features aren't apparent; you only see the small size. Of course that view soon changes when you actually start to use it.

With the special SIP packaging the Petito is not only small and fast but also very sturdy and resilient. It can endure low and high temperatures, its water- and shockproof and it can handle static charges well. That means it's not a fragile drive.

So this drive basically covers four good basic selling points in terms of style, size, packaging and speed. Not many drives can pull those points off, but the Petito certainly can. I think, if the pricing is right for this drive, that it might become very popular. It certainly has all the makings to do so.

While trying out the Petito, the only con I was able to find was the availability of the drive. In particular, the drive isn't readily available in Europe. Of course this is only a matter of short time, as the Petito is being introduced in Europe as we speak, this review helps make its presence known too.

Review system specifications
Processor:AMD Athlon 64 X2 4400+
Memory:2048 MB DDR 400MHz
Hard drives: 2x 250 GB DiamondMax 10 SATA disks (Mirrored RAID)
Motherboard:Asus A8N Sli
Operating System:Windows XP Professional SP2
Recording devices:Philips DVDR 1660P1 and NEC ND-4551A
